fortinet.fortimanager.fmgr_switchcontroller_managedswitch – Configure FortiSwitch devices that are managed by this FortiGate.
Note
This plugin is part of the fortinet.fortimanager collection (version 2.1.3).
You might already have this collection installed if you are using the ansible
package. It is not included in ansible-core
. To check whether it is installed, run ansible-galaxy collection list
.
To install it, use: ansible-galaxy collection install fortinet.fortimanager
.
To use it in a playbook, specify: fortinet.fortimanager.fmgr_switchcontroller_managedswitch
.
New in version 2.10: of fortinet.fortimanager
Synopsis
- This module is able to configure a FortiManager device.
- Examples include all parameters and values which need to be adjusted to data sources before usage.

Notes
Note
- Running in workspace locking mode is supported in this FortiManager module, the top level parameters workspace_locking_adom and workspace_locking_timeout help do the work.
- To create or update an object, use state present directive.
- To delete an object, use state absent directive.
- Normally, running one module can fail when a non-zero rc is returned. you can also override the conditions to fail or succeed with parameters rc_failed and rc_succeeded
Examples
- hosts: fortimanager-inventory
collections:
- fortinet.fortimanager
connection: httpapi
vars:
ansible_httpapi_use_ssl: True
ansible_httpapi_validate_certs: False
ansible_httpapi_port: 443
tasks:
- name: Configure FortiSwitch devices that are managed by this FortiGate.
fmgr_switchcontroller_managedswitch:
bypass_validation: False
workspace_locking_adom: <value in [global, custom adom including root]>
workspace_locking_timeout: 300
rc_succeeded: [0, -2, -3, ...]
rc_failed: [-2, -3, ...]
adom: <your own value>
state: <value in [present, absent]>
switchcontroller_managedswitch:
_platform: <value of string>
description: <value of string>
name: <value of string>
ports:
-
allowed-vlans: <value of string>
allowed-vlans-all: <value in [disable, enable]>
arp-inspection-trust: <value in [untrusted, trusted]>
bundle: <value in [disable, enable]>
description: <value of string>
dhcp-snoop-option82-trust: <value in [disable, enable]>
dhcp-snooping: <value in [trusted, untrusted]>
discard-mode: <value in [none, all-untagged, all-tagged]>
edge-port: <value in [disable, enable]>
igmp-snooping: <value in [disable, enable]>
igmps-flood-reports: <value in [disable, enable]>
igmps-flood-traffic: <value in [disable, enable]>
lacp-speed: <value in [slow, fast]>
learning-limit: <value of integer>
lldp-profile: <value of string>
lldp-status: <value in [disable, rx-only, tx-only, ...]>
loop-guard: <value in [disabled, enabled]>
loop-guard-timeout: <value of integer>
max-bundle: <value of integer>
mclag: <value in [disable, enable]>
member-withdrawal-behavior: <value in [forward, block]>
members: <value of string>
min-bundle: <value of integer>
mode: <value in [static, lacp-passive, lacp-active]>
poe-pre-standard-detection: <value in [disable, enable]>
poe-status: <value in [disable, enable]>
port-name: <value of string>
port-owner: <value of string>
port-security-policy: <value of string>
port-selection-criteria: <value in [src-mac, dst-mac, src-dst-mac, ...]>
qos-policy: <value of string>
sample-direction: <value in [rx, tx, both]>
sflow-counter-interval: <value of integer>
sflow-sample-rate: <value of integer>
sflow-sampler: <value in [disabled, enabled]>
stp-bpdu-guard: <value in [disabled, enabled]>
